Output 58308cc61d05285397e2f5a53c6ac39e4f733e4bca1fbfb22971b034935cb368:0

value
923832877
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8bc6306210e8cd94bd42b3a748d585846f12f4c9 OP_EQUAL
address
3ES5GcyWCENt58BzNDRCPik7tdHQJyhpFa
transaction
58308cc61d05285397e2f5a53c6ac39e4f733e4bca1fbfb22971b034935cb368
spent
true